Nottingham Forest have resumed talks with Crystal Palace for goalkeeper Sam Johnstone after a loan offer was dismissed earlier this week.

Forest are proposing a £15m deal for 30-year-old Johnstone who is keen on the move to boost his chances of a return to the England squad.

Johnstone has won four England caps since making his senior international bow in 2021, but faces competition from the likes of Jordan Pickford, Dean Henderson, Aaron Ramsdale and Nick Pope for a place in Gareth Southgate’s squad at this summer’s European Championships.

Despite having since returned to fitness, Henderson has marked his place as Roy Hodgson’s No 1 at Selhurst Park, with Johnstone relegated to the bench.

Johnstone’s last appearance for the Eagles came during their defeat against Everton in the FA Cup third-round replay at Goodison Park earlier this month.

Forest have been in the market for a replacement goalkeeper with both Matt Turner and Odysseas Vlachodimos failing to impress in East Midlands.

Former Leicester goalkeeper Kasper Schmeichel has emerged as a potential option, with the 37-year-old currently playing for Belgian giants Anderlecht.

Nuno Espirito Santo’s side also completed the loan signings of Gio Reyna from Borussia Dortmund and Sporting Lisbon forward Rodrigo Ribeiro, 18.
